Nabeel Masih, just 16 years old when his life was torn apart, has endured a nightmare no child should ever have to face. Arrested falsely on charges of blasphemy in Phoolnagar, District Kasur, on 18th September 2016, Nabeel was thrust into a world of pain and injustice. A child, accused of […]

In Pakistan, where religious intolerance runs deep, the Ahmadi community continues to face systemic persecution and violence. A recent incident in Samanabad is a poignant reminder of their vulnerability and the constant fear that hangs over their heads. The plight of oppressed religious minorities in Pakistan is a poignant issue that necessitates immediate attention and proactive action. Amidst a Muslim-majority populace, the country’s religious minorities include Hindus, Christians, Sikhs, Ahmadiyya, and other smaller sects and religions. These communities have a rich cultural heritage and contribute significantly to the societal fabric of the nation.
